However, according to the report, it is likely to be recalled both in T20i and test squads when the selectors meet later this month. The Asian Cup, scheduled for September 9, will be played in T20 format, while the Antilles series with two tests will start on October 2 in Ahmedabad.
But when did Ier have the last feature of India in these formats?In T20is, Iyer played for the last time in December 2023 against Australia in Bengaluru, marking 53 winning balls of 53 balls in a six -point victory. He has 51 T20is in his name, amazing 1104 points at an average of 30.66 and a strike rate of 136.12, including eight fifty.In the tests, his last appearance took place in February 2024 against England in Visakhapatnam, where he scored 27 and 29 in a match that India won by 106 points. Through 14 tests, he has 811 points at 36.86 with a century and five fifty.The 30 -year -old was appointed to the West Zone team for the Duleep trophy, from August 28 at the BCCI Center of Excellence. West Zone, the reigning champions, will start directly from the semi-finals on September 4.The absence of an Iyer test came from a back injury and a bad shape in the England series last year, aggravated by the controversy on its reluctance to play domestic cricket. Since then, he has rebuilt his case, marking 480 points at 68.57 – with two centuries – for Mumbai in the Ranji trophy last season, and at the top of the prize list of India during their triumph of the Champions Trophy in March with 243 points at 48.60.
